| abstract note | "About 5 years ago, a number of Zoroastrians of Persia (Irânis) in Bombay complained, that some of their compatriots in Bombay follow the religion of Bâb and are adopting Babiism. Those who hold the belief came and saw me and explained their belief. I studied the life and the teachings of Bâb. I learnt from these, and from the conversation I had with the so-called Zoroastrian Babis, that Bâb* who appeared in Persia in the middle of the last century (born in 1824 A.D.) was taken by some of these simple folks to be the Soshyôs [Messiah or Saviour] predicted in the Avesta, and by others to be the Behram Verjâvand alluded to in some of the later Pahlavi and Persian books..." |
